Overview

Admiral Markets (now Admirals) is a global broker headquartered in Estonia with a comprehensive asset offering (5000+) in CFDs and real stocks or ETFs along with MetaTrader 4 & 5.

Nextmarkets is a german broker founded in 2014 that specialises in commission free stocks and ETFs trading through their proprietary platform which offers an expert advisory service via live coaches that suggest their trading ideas.
